Dartmouth-Hitchcock is an academic health system based in Lebanon, New Hampshire, serving patients across northern New England and employing a large regional workforce. It offers access to a broad network of providers and care facilities, anchored by Dartmouth Hitchcock Medical Center in Lebanon and extending through hospitals, clinics, and ambulatory sites across New Hampshire and Vermont. The system includes the Dartmouth Cancer Center, an NCI-designated Comprehensive Cancer Center - the only one in northern New England - and Dartmouth Health Children's, housed at the state's only children's hospital. Through its historic partnership with Dartmouth College and the Geisel School of Medicine, it trains nearly 400 medical residents and fellows annually and conducts research and clinical trials in collaboration with Geisel and the White River Junction VA Medical Center. It also operates additional member hospitals in New Hampshire and Vermont, along with Visiting Nurse and Hospice for Vermont and New Hampshire and more than two dozen ambulatory clinics, reflecting a broad regional footprint. In 2026, it announced a first-in-region postpartum hemorrhage drug-treatment program at its birthing pavilion, illustrating ongoing clinical innovation.
